[SECTION]Bike Week: 16 to 24 March[/SECTION]

Bike Week is not just for the lycra-clad cycling elite. It's for everyone, regardless of your fitness and cycling ability (or lack of them). There's a huge program of events over eight days and most of them are family friendly and free. Choose from a full program of activities including 10-Speed Dating , a leisurely bike ride and coffee after; Papergirl Brisbane , the distribution of free artworks to the public via bicycle; a Film Night at El Dorado Cinema Indooroopilly; and the popular Post Ride Festival at South Bank to conclude the Bike Week celebrations.


Details
When: From Saturday 16 March to Sunday 24 March
Where: Various Brisbane venues, depending on specific event. See program for details.

[SECTION]Sheffield Shield, Bulls Vs Tasmania: 7 to 10 March[/SECTION]

Forget the woes of our Australian cricket team in India and the exorbitant costs and huge, unruly crowds of international cricket events. Come along and see some top-notch cricket with some of the country's best cricketers in action. The Sheffield Shield is the country's premier cricket competition. The Queensland Bulls, fresh from their win in the one day form of the game will be taking on the Tassie Tigers at the Gabba.


When: From Thursday 7 to Sunday 10 March. Gates open at 9.30am and play begins at 10am.
Where: The Gabba. Entry via Gate 4, Vulture Street, Woolloongabba.

[SECTION]Brisbane Irish Festival: 9 to 17 March[/SECTION]

Brisbane Irish Festival is just the excuse everyone needs to claim Irish ancestry and some affinity with The Emerald Isle, no matter how remote. It used to just be St Patrick's Day with green beer and the annual parade but that's no longer enough to accommodate all that Irishness. Now a whole week is set aside for celebrations that include the parade, a family sports day, concerts, and a dinner. Read Debra's article here for the lowdown on all that's happening.


When: From Saturday 9 March to Sunday 17 March
Where: Various venues around Brisbane.

[SECTION]Holiday and Travel Show: 23 to 24 March[/SECTION]

This year's Holiday and Travel Show Mega Show incorporates 4 shows in one: The Holiday and Travel Show, The Snow Show, The Cruise Show and the Adventure Travel Expo. That sounds like all your travel bases covered to me. If you're planning a holiday or just dreaming this is the event for you. As well as stands from a range of travel and holiday exhibitors there will be cultural performances encompassing fashion and food, seminar rooms for films, talks and presentations, and handicraft workshops. You can also win thousands of dollars worth of prizes.And it's all free.


When: Saturday 23 and Sunday 24 March from 10am to 4.30pm
Where: Brisbane Convention and Exhibition Centre, South Bank
